Transaction 061958650c93bf362e54816a123ff9258e9f527de799d6b75e924a2c3980179f

1 Input
2 Outputs
  • 061958650c93bf362e54816a123ff9258e9f527de799d6b75e924a2c3980179f:0
  • value  456796
    address  1MbfyMr2ksYAqrr9AeFW5PRVYe69SGpYyZ
  • 061958650c93bf362e54816a123ff9258e9f527de799d6b75e924a2c3980179f:1
  • value  630274
    address  37yabAyJaXrHWRxnstrcRfRqZsZaX4y79v